Talgarth Town Hall (original) (raw)

Talgarth Town Hall (Welsh: Neuadd y Dref Talgarth), is a municipal building on The Bank, Talgarth, Powys, Wales. The structure, which is the meeting place of Talgarth Town Council, is a Grade II listed building.

thumbnail